Mawlanā Syed Muntakhab al-Ḥaqq (Urdu: منتخب الحق) was the dean of the faculty of Islamic studies at theUniversity of Karachi, Pakistan, from 1964 to 1972.[1] He was named a jurisconsult to theFederal Shariat Court in 1981,[2] and appointed to theCouncil of Islamic Ideology in 1982.
